No, grass clippings, compost, tree leaves can not be added to the unit as it takes much time to be digested and will end up consuming more space of your digester and interrupting the biogas production. It is important to place your system close to a water source and to have a free 0.5 meter from each of the systems sides to have easy access to the system. This process produces a mixture of gases primarily methane, some carbon dioxide, and tiny portions of other gases, such as hydrogen sulphide. Biogas technology is a generic term for the technologies associated with the anaerobic digestion of organic waste (food waste, animal waste, sewage etc) to produce methane gas and an organic sludge (a recyclable by-product).
